So Yurt and SRJSS or whatever the idiot's name is support giving guns to our teachers like we do airline pilots.

Neither has answered who will pay for this.

The airline pilots are furnished guns via the U.S. Government and complete a week's training at the FLETC branch training facility in New Mexico.

There are approximately 6.6 million teachers in this country. To arm each one of them and would be two billion nine hundred seventy million dollars based upon $450 per weapon, not including the cost of training.

So, the question is simple.

WHO'S GOING TO PAY?
